💰 SEGMENT 1: The 5 Revenue Streams of Viral Creators

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Here are the 5 revenue streams every viral creator should build:

💰 The 5 Revenue Streams

  1. Ad Revenue: YouTube, TikTok, Facebook ad shares
  2. Brand Deals & Sponsorships: Paid partnerships
  3. Affiliate Marketing: Commission on product sales
  4. Digital Products: Courses, ebooks, templates
  5. Cross-Platform Growth: Using viral momentum to grow email lists and other channels
🍵 Matcha Maya

I'm only doing ad revenue right now. That's probably why I'm not making much.

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Exactly. Relying on ad revenue alone is a mistake. It's the least predictable and lowest-paying stream for most creators. Let's break down each one.


📊 SEGMENT 2: Ad Revenue — Platform Comparison

Platform Requirements RPM (Revenue Per Mille) Pros & Cons
TikTok 10K+ followers, 100K+ views in 30 days $0.02–0.05 Pros: Easy to qualify. Cons: Very low pay.
YouTube Shorts 1K+ subscribers, 10M+ Shorts views in 90 days $0.10–0.30 Pros: Best paying. Cons: Requires subscriber threshold.
Instagram Reels Invite-only bonus program Varies Pros: No threshold for bonuses. Cons: Limited availability.
Facebook Video 10K+ followers $0.05–0.15 Pros: Established program. Cons: Declining audiences.
👨‍🏫 Teacher

As you can see, ad revenue alone won't make you rich. In my 90-day experiment, YouTube Shorts earned $892, TikTok earned $234, and Reels earned $0 from ad revenue alone. For more on this, read our full monetization guide.


🤝 SEGMENT 3: Brand Deals & Sponsorships

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Brand deals are where the real money is. A single brand deal can pay more than months of ad revenue.

Average brand deal rates (2026):

  • 10K followers: $200–500 per post
  • 50K followers: $500–2,000 per post
  • 100K followers: $2,000–10,000 per post
  • 1M+ followers: $10,000+ per post
🥑 Acai Gomez

How do I get brands to notice me?

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Don't wait for brands to find you. Create a media kit and pitch to brands you already use and love. Authenticity is key — brands want creators who genuinely use their products.

🔗 SEGMENT 4: Affiliate Marketing

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Affiliate marketing is passive income. You recommend products and earn a commission when someone buys through your link.

Best affiliate networks for creators:

  • Amazon Associates: Best for product recommendations
  • ShareASale: Wide variety of brands
  • Rakuten: High-quality brands
  • Impact: Premium brands
🍵 Matcha Maya

I use the Insta360 X5 in my videos. Can I become an affiliate for them?

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Yes! Many brands have affiliate programs. Check their website or search for "Insta360 affiliate program." Always disclose affiliate links — it's required by the FTC.

🔄 SEGMENT 6: The Conversion Funnel

👨‍🏫 Teacher

Here's the Conversion Funnel that turns views into revenue:

  1. Views → Viral content builds awareness
  2. Engagement → Comments and shares build trust
  3. Trust → Consistent value builds authority
  4. Conversion → Authority leads to sales

Remember: your video is not the product. Your video is the advertisement for the product.
